Complete Buying Guide for Hardtail Mountain Bikes

Essential Factors We Consider

When selecting the best hardtail mountain bike for beginners, we focus on several critical factors. Frame quality and material determine durability and weight, with aluminum being the most common and cost-effective option. Suspension travel affects how well the bike handles different terrains, typically ranging from 50-100mm for entry-level models. Wheel size impacts stability and maneuverability, with 26″, 27.5″, and 29″ being the main options. Gear systems should offer enough range for varied terrain while remaining user-friendly.

Budget Planning

Hardtail mountain bikes for beginners typically range from $200 to $800, with quality increasing significantly around the $400 mark. Entry-level bikes under $300 often sacrifice build quality for affordability, while mid-range options ($400-$600) provide the best balance of features and reliability. Higher-end models ($600+) offer better components but may exceed beginner budgets unnecessarily. Always factor in additional costs like helmets, protective gear, maintenance tools, and potential upgrades.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: What makes a hardtail mountain bike suitable for beginners?

A: Hardtail mountain bikes are ideal for beginners because they feature front suspension only, keeping the design simpler and more affordable while still providing enough comfort for trail riding. The absence of rear suspension reduces complexity, maintenance needs, and cost while teaching fundamental riding skills.

Q: How do I know what size hardtail mountain bike I need?

A: Most manufacturers provide detailed size charts based on rider height and inseam measurements. Generally, 16″-18″ frames suit smaller riders (under 5’4″), 18″-20″ frames work for average heights (5’4″-5’10”), and 20″+ frames accommodate taller riders (5’10″+). Always try before buying if possible.

Q: What maintenance do hardtail mountain bikes require?

A: Regular maintenance includes cleaning the chain, checking tire pressure before each ride, inspecting brake pads and cables, ensuring proper gear alignment, and lubricating moving parts. Professional tune-ups every 6-12 months are recommended for optimal performance.

Q: Can I upgrade my beginner hardtail mountain bike later?

A: Absolutely! Most beginner hardtails allow for component upgrades like handlebars, seats, pedals, and drivetrain parts. However, frame upgrades are limited, so consider your long-term goals when choosing your initial bike. Starting with a solid foundation frame pays dividends later.
